Synonyms for hazard

Noun

1. hazard, jeopardy, peril, risk, danger
usage: a source of danger; a possibility of incurring loss or misfortune; "drinking alcohol is a health hazard"
2. luck, fortune, chance, hazard, phenomenon
usage: an unknown and unpredictable phenomenon that causes an event to result one way rather than another; "bad luck caused his downfall"; "we ran into each other by pure chance"
3. hazard, obstacle
usage: an obstacle on a golf course

Verb

1. guess, venture, pretend, hazard, speculate
usage: put forward, of a guess, in spite of possible refutation; "I am guessing that the price of real estate will rise again"; "I cannot pretend to say that you are wrong"
2. venture, hazard, adventure, stake, jeopardize, risk, put on the line, lay on the line
usage: put at risk; "I will stake my good reputation for this"
3. gamble, chance, risk, hazard, take chances, adventure, run a risk, take a chance, try, seek, attempt, essay, assay
usage: take a risk in the hope of a favorable outcome; "When you buy these stocks you are gambling"
